'If Looks Could Kill' by Sean Armenta Means Risky Business

— September 1, 2010 — Fashion
'If Looks Could Kill' by Sean Armenta is a serious photoshoot, featuring some dangerous-looking men with some serious weapons.

Armenta manages to make these men look dangerous even while modeling with an umbrella. However, it could be the dungeon-esque background and chains which create such an illusion. I love the gloomy feel of this photoshoot, combining the horror movie theme with a touch of class. 'If Looks Could Kill' by Sean Armenta is undeniably strangely alluring.
